ASI Industries Ltd reported audited financial results for FY2025-26 with revenue from operations declining to Rs. 14,941.44 Lakhs from Rs. 15,476.56 Lakhs in the previous year, representing approximately 3.5% year-on-year decline. Profit after tax (PAT) fell to Rs. 2,269.48 Lakhs from Rs. 2,544.92 Lakhs, down about 10.8%. EPS for the year stood at Rs. 2.52 compared to Rs. 2.83 in FY25. The board recommended a dividend of Rs. 0.40 per share (40% on Rs. 1 face value). Operating cash flow turned positive at Rs. 1,572.76 Lakhs versus negative Rs. 336.41 Lakhs in the prior year. The statutory auditor issued an unmodified (clean) audit opinion. The audit committee was also reconstituted with new members.
The decline in revenue and PAT indicates operational challenges, though the strong positive operating cash flow and dividend payout signal management confidence. The clean audit provides assurance on financial reporting quality. Shareholders can expect dividend income pending AGM approval.
